Introduction: Piaget's Theory Under Scrutiny

Jean Piaget's theories of child development have been generalized and widely accepted across the domains of psychology, child development, and education. It would not be inappropriate to label him as one of the most significant thinkers in the modern practice of these fields. Yet his work is not unassailable. He based the majority of his observations on the study of his own children, and some critics have argued that he insufficiently explores the impact of cultural differences and the issue of giftedness among children. Intellectually gifted children may move through the stages differently, or perhaps with more self-awareness (Cohen & Kim, 1999). Piaget's theories have remained under scrutiny, for these and other reasons, since their inception. To this day there is little agreement as to the precise accuracy of his stages or the way in which they may be measured and determined.

Piaget himself measured the shift between stages by a child's ability to succeed in specific theory tasks that demonstrate certain cognitive skills, such as the ability to comprehend different points of view or the ability to conserve numbers, area, volume, and so forth in relation to objects.

Research Supporting Piaget's Stages

Many developmental studies have utilized Piaget's theories and found them to be reliable. For example, Uri Fidelman (1995) performed one study in which kindergarten children were tested for performance on the Piaget-designed stage task, asked to conserve numbers over varying spatial arrangements. At the same time they were tested for the development of right-brain or left-brain capability. Over the following year the children were tested again, and many of them were seen to shift stages and begin to conserve numbers. Those who underwent such a shift also experienced changes in the development of their brain hemispheres, with males and females becoming more alike at that point. This study, in addition to contributing to gender and sex research, seems to indicate a real biological core to Piaget's theories. Of course, it could be argued that the changes in cognition and hemisphere capability were coincidental — both attributable to the child's general maturation rather than directly linked to one another.

Social Pressure and Its Effect on Children's Responses

Arguments against a strict reliance on Piaget's stages have amassed in the years since he introduced the theory. The strongest of these arguments point out that, though his stages may have some legitimacy as a general outline of childhood development, they vastly underrate the actual capabilities of most children by using tests that are inherently skewed against socially sensitive children. These studies argue that children do indeed think differently than adults, but that this difference involves major factors Piaget did not take into consideration — the most commonly cited being the social factor.

Children are socially dependent on adults for information and, perhaps more importantly, for what might be called permission. Adults consistently assert their power over children, with responses such as "because I said so" being treated as legitimate logic by many parents and teachers. Children are expected to surrender their own opinions, even when correct, in deference to adult opinion. Those who refuse may be physically punished, socially humiliated, or otherwise penalized — some are even treated with psychoactive drugs, given that defiance of authority is considered a primary symptom of "oppositional disorder." Children also depend entirely on adults for food, shelter, and all the basic necessities of life. As many feminist scholars note, dependent groups tend to be discouraged from forcefully asserting their own views of the world.

Though most studies do not raise the serious question of how children are expected to surrender their opinions, they do note that the younger a child is, the more hypersensitive they are to social atmosphere and subtle adult pressure. In the most basic structure of a Piaget test, an adult asks a child an apparently straightforward question — such as "are these lines the same length?" — and then, after the child answers, makes some actually inconsequential change (such as repositioning the line or spacing the elements differently) and reiterates the question. As anyone who has been questioned by an authority figure will recognize, repetition of a question is socially understood, even by adults, to generally mean that the first answer was not good enough.

Many studies have suggested that children may be subtly attempting to placate the adult by changing their first answer, which the adult apparently found incorrect. Even adults have been shown to change their reports of known facts in response to social pressure. Solomon Asch's landmark study (1955) showed that when adult male college students were asked to judge which of four lines matched a target line — an easier task than Piaget's conservation of numbers — they made 33% wrong identifications when all their peers in the study gave the wrong answer. This social isolation made them question their own perceptions. If mild social pressure affects adult men in this way, one can certainly expect the more immediate social pressure of having an adult question a child's perception to be enough to elicit a wrong answer from a child.

Experimental Modifications That Improve Child Performance

If children are simply responding to subtle cues from the interviewer, then experimental studies should bear this out — and they do. McGarrigle and Donaldson (1974) found that when Piaget stage tasks were conducted in a way that minimized the appearance that the first answer was wrong, the success rate of an average group of four-year-old children jumped from 22.5% to 80% — a complete reversal of the trend toward failure for that age group. In this study, the researchers pretended that a "Naughty Teddy" toy had escaped from his cage and disturbed the lines of objects. The researcher then asked the child to help make sure the lines still contained the same number of objects. Not only could 80% of the children succeed at this task, they did so despite not being entirely certain that Naughty Teddy had not removed objects, added new ones, or otherwise altered the contents of the two lines.

Light et al. (1979) critiqued the Naughty Teddy design as a significant distraction from the task, and suggested that even higher numbers would have succeeded had the bear not diverted the children's attention. Light et al. (1979) also demonstrated that the classic liquid conservation study would show significantly higher rates of conservation if the researcher justified pouring liquid from one vial to another by noting that the former beaker was chipped and had to be replaced.

Judith Samuel and Peter Bryant (1984) achieved a similar result by asking only one question per task. They arranged a conservation test in which children were divided into three groups and presented with clay balls that were subsequently flattened into cylinders — a traditional Piaget task. One group received two questions in the traditional format. The second group was not asked whether the first set was equal; instead, they watched the balls being flattened and were then asked whether they were equal. The third group did not even see the two balls — only one ball and one cylinder. The first and third groups performed significantly more poorly than the second group, demonstrating that children could carry knowledge over from having seen the ball transformed, and that adult intervention altered their representation of that knowledge.
